Freedom Park Lagos is a stunning national park that combines rich history with natural beauty, offering tourists a tranquil escape in the heart of Lagos. This beautifully landscaped park, once a colonial-era prison, now serves as a vibrant cultural space where visitors can relax, explore art installations, and enjoy live performances amidst lush greenery.

Local tips
- Visit during the late afternoon for a cooler experience and beautiful sunset views.
- Check the park's schedule for events or performances to enhance your visit.
- Bring a camera, as the park offers numerous picturesque spots for great photography.
- Wear comfortable shoes for walking, as there are many paths to explore.
